Compliance and Regulatory Obligations
When selecting a registered agent, understanding their compliance and legal responsibilities is essential. A designated representative serves as a point of contact between your business and the government, intercepting formal communications and judicial papers on behalf of your organization. They are accountable for ensuring that your company meets all statutory requirements, including on-time submission of yearly filings and regulatory alerts. This implies that the representative must be vigilant and systematic, keeping track of due dates and updates in regulations to help maintain your business’s good standing.
Additionally, designated representatives must be available during regular operating hours to receive legal delivery services. This is imperative for judicial communications, as not getting these documents can result in default judgments against your company. Reliable agents will inform you immediately of any legal documents received, ensuring that your business can respond promptly within designated deadlines. Selecting an agent with a strong commitment to these obligations will assist in safeguarding your company against possible legal pitfalls.
Lastly, registered agents must comply with state-specific regulations concerning their duties. Every state has different requirements regarding who can act as a registered agent, the need for a physical address in that state, and the obligations for upholding privacy. Understanding these regulations helps prevent problems that could arise from substandard advocacy or missed compliance deadlines. Therefore, selecting a professional registered agent that is familiar about your state's regulatory environment is essential for your company continuity and regulatory safety.
Changing Your Registered Agent
Changing your appointed agent is a simple process, but it’s important to adhere to your state's specific requirements to confirm compliance. Generally, this involves providing a designated agent change form to the relevant state authority. It’s crucial to check the regulations of your state, as the regulations may differ. Some jurisdictions may demand the written consent of the new registered agent as part of the update process.
Once you have finished the necessary paperwork, you may need to indicate the effective date of the update, especially if you want it to coincide with the upcoming annual compliance submission. After the submission is officially recognized, it is advisable to revise your business records and inform relevant parties who may be affected by the change, such as customers or partners. Ensuring that all previous agent obligations are smoothly transitioned is key to maintaining legal compliance.
